Chapitre 4
: démarrage de l’ordinateur
Pour bien comprendre un ordinateur, on doit bien connaitre le processus démarrage et comment le lien
entre le matériel et le logiciel. Le processus de démarrage (boot) débute lorsque le commutateur de la
machine est actif et se termine lorsque le système d’opération est chargé.
Le processus de démarrage est une série d’étapes séquentielles exécutées par l’ordinateur, si l’une des
étapes n’est pas exécutée ou génère une erreur, l’ordinateur ne peut pas démarrer.
Avant de procéder au démarrage d’un pc, il faut bien se rassurer de la disponibilité des choses suivantes
Alimentation suffisante en énergie électrique ;
La bonne connexion de tous les périphériques absolument nécessaires au démarrage ;
La présence des applications permettant d’arriver au bureau.
Tous les ordinateurs démarrent à partir d’un point situé appelé bouton de démarrage.
Etapes de démarrage
Alimentation de l’ordinateur ;
Chargement du BIOS de base et vérification du matériel ;
Chargement du système d’exploitation.
Alimentation de l’ordinateur
Pour pouvoir fonctionner, l’ordinateur a besoin d’alimentation. Celui envoie un signal Power-On au
processeur.
Chargement du BIOS de base et vérification du matériel
Pour qu’un ordinateur puisse opérer convenablement, les composantes matérielles doivent être
fonctionnelles. Le BIOS de base, situé dans la puce ROM (pour un PC cette adresse est située à 16 octets
sous le niveau des 1024 Ko, ou plus précisément à l’adresse FFFF : 0000) contient la routine qui permet
de découvrir le matériel installer sur l’ordinateur et de vérifier s’il est fonctionnel.
Au début du démarrage, aucun logiciel n’est chargé en mémoire. Le processeur commence par exécuter
les instructions qui se trouvent dans le BIOS de base. Le BIOS de base contient des pilotes pour contrôler
les disques, le clavier et d’autres périphériques similaires. Ce processus comporte 4 étapes :
Vérification d’une partie de la mémoire basse ;
Le parcours du système pour trouver d’autres BIOS ;
L’octroi de l’initialisation aux autres BIOS ;
L’inventaire et la vérification du système.
Vérification d’une partie de la mémoire basse
Puisse que le BIOS a besoin de la mémoire basse pour fonctionner, la première étape qu’il exécute est la
vérification d’une partie de la mémoire basse. Si cette vérification échoue, la majorité des BIOS ne
pourront être réactivés et le système sera alors hors fonction (crash).
Le parcours du système pour trouver d’autres BIOS
Limité par un espace mémoire restreint, le BIOS de base ne peut pas connaitre tous les périphériques
possibles, tels que les cartes réseaux, la carte vidéo non usuelle, etc. Plusieurs cartes d’extensions
possèdent leurs propres BIOS qui contiennent des instructions d’initialisation qui leurs sont propres. Par
exemple, la carte réseau peut diffuser une adresse IP pour vérifier son unicité, la carte vidéo peut tester
sa mémoire.
L’octroi de l’initialisation aux autres BIOS
Le BIOS de base permet à certaines cartes d’extension ayant les capacités requises de faire leurs propres
initialisations. Cependant, il doit d’abord trouver ces BIOS en examinant la mémoire qui se situe entre
768 Ko et 960 Ko